10 facts about this song
Release & Album"Waitin' on a Sunny Day" is a song by American musician Bruce Springsteen, taken from his twelfth studio album, "The Rising", that was released in 2002.
|
Song CompositionThe song features a joyous and upbeat rhythm highly influenced by the pop/rock style Springsteen is known for. The track is written from the perspective of a man waiting for happier times, reflected in its metaphorical 'sunny day'.
|
Critical Reception"Waitin' on a Sunny Day", despite not being a single in the United States, ended up being one of Springsteen's better-known songs amongst recent material.
|
Live PerformancesSpringsteen often lets the audience sing some of the song during live performances and he has also been noted to bring children onto stage to sing portions of the song.
|
Music VideoThe popular music video for the song, directed by Chris Hilson and featuring black and white shots of Springsteen in Asbury Park, NJ, was released in 2003.
|
Chart PerformanceAlthough the song was released as a single in several countries, it turned out to be a moderate chart success, hitting the Top 20 in countries like the Netherlands and the UK.
|
Album ThemeThe album "The Rising" reflected Springsteen's response to the September 11 attacks. While "Waitin' on a Sunny Day" is one of the album's breezier tracks, it is somewhat shaded by the overarching theme of the album.
|
Song CreditsSpringsteen was not only the singer but also the principal songwriter for "Waitin' on a Sunny Day", which has become a staple in his discography.
|
Song MeaningThe song's lyrics speak about a love that's lost but also the hope for a bright, sunny day–a metaphor for better times ahead.
|
Popularity Beyond the ChartsDespite not being one of Springsteen's highest-charting songs, "Waitin' on a Sunny Day" has remained a fan favorite and is often included in his live performances, demonstrating its enduring popularity.
